You need more passenger connections with planes (and boats) than with other modes. But you're city may still be too small.
Same for airtravel. If there are alternative, maybe even faster options, why should anyone pay extra? Either use it as an only option or make sure that there is a lot of difference in travel time. Travel time is not just the speed of the aircraft...

If growth is your goal then it's pretty vital to try to connect cities as fast/soon as possible. Simple buslines will do, and basically it doesn't really matter that much how much how efficient they are, as soon as you connect cities, growth will be triggered.
So getting 4k - 5k cities around 2000 is pretty easy that way, but on the other hand, you might not even want to grow that many cities too big as this will eat into performance. Personally i try to get a few 'capitals' per map (on very large maps 4 or 5 of them) which i try to give as many connections as possible.
